Simplicity and Clarity

One of the most important elements of a great gardening business logo is simplicity and clarity. Your logo should be easily recognizable and memorable, which means avoiding cluttered designs or intricate details that can be overwhelming. A simple and clean logo will make it easier for customers to identify and remember your brand, especially when it comes to print materials such as business cards, flyers, or signage.

Versatility

Another essential element of a great gardening business logo is versatility. Your logo should be able to adapt to different platforms and applications without losing its impact or readability.

Whether it’s being displayed on a website, social media profile, or printed on merchandise, your logo should maintain its integrity and remain visually appealing. Keep in mind that scalability is also crucial, as your logo should look good whether it’s scaled down for a small promotional item or blown up for a large banner.

Originality

Finally, originality is key when it comes to designing a great gardening business logo. While it’s okay to draw inspiration from other logos or trends in the industry, your logo should ultimately be unique to your brand. This originality will help your business stand out from competitors and establish a strong visual identity in the minds of consumers.

Color Psychology in Logo Design

When it comes to designing a logo for your gardening business, color plays a crucial role in conveying the right message to your target audience. The colors you choose can evoke specific emotions and associations, so it’s essential to consider the psychology behind each color before making a decision.

The Importance of Color Psychology

Understanding the impact of color psychology can help you make informed decisions when creating your gardening business logo. For example, green is often associated with growth, harmony, and nature, making it a popular choice for logos in the gardening industry. On the other hand, vibrant shades of yellow can convey feelings of happiness and optimism, which may be suitable for businesses focusing on garden design and landscaping.

Choosing the Right Colors

When selecting colors for your gardening business logo, consider your brand identity and target audience. If your business specializes in sustainable gardening practices or eco-friendly products, earthy tones like brown and green may be ideal choices. Alternatively, if you offer modern and innovative gardening services, using a combination of bold colors such as red and orange can help create a dynamic and energetic brand image.

Using Colors Strategically



Incorporating different colors into your logo design can also represent various aspects of your gardening business. For instance, using blue hues may symbolize reliability and trustworthiness – characteristics that are important to convey if you offer maintenance or landscaping services. Additionally, utilizing complementary colors effectively can help create visual interest while maintaining harmony within your logo design.

By understanding color psychology and strategically selecting the right colors for your logo, you can effectively communicate the values and personality of your gardening business to potential customers.

Typography Tips for Gardening Business Logos

When it comes to creating a memorable and effective gardening business logo, choosing the right fonts is crucial in representing your brand. Typography plays a significant role in conveying the personality and style of your business, so it’s important to select fonts that align with your brand identity. Here are some typography tips for gardening business logos:

Serif vs. Sans Serif Fonts

When choosing fonts for your gardening business logo, consider whether you want to use serif or sans serif fonts. Serif fonts are known for their classic and elegant appearance, while sans serif fonts have a more modern and clean look. Depending on the image you want to portray for your gardening business, selecting the right type of font is essential.

Readability

One of the most important factors to consider when choosing fonts for your logo is readability. Your logo should be easily recognizable and legible, even at smaller sizes. Avoid using overly decorative or intricate fonts that may be difficult to read, especially from a distance.

Reflecting Your Brand Personality

The typography you choose for your gardening business logo should reflect the personality of your brand. If your business has a more traditional and established image, you may opt for serif fonts with a timeless appeal. On the other hand, if your gardening business has a more contemporary and fresh vibe, sans serif fonts could be more appropriate.

Logo Design Trends in the Gardening Industry

In the gardening industry, logo design trends are constantly evolving, and it’s important for businesses to stay updated on what’s hot and what’s not in order to keep their brand relevant and appealing to customers. Here are some current logo design trends that gardening businesses should consider when creating or updating their logos:

  • Minimalism: Clean, simple designs that convey a sense of elegance and sophistication are becoming increasingly popular in the gardening industry. Logos with minimalist designs often use sleek lines and basic shapes to represent nature and the environment.
  • Illustrative Logos: Many gardening businesses are opting for illustrative logos that feature hand-drawn or digitally rendered images of plants, flowers, or trees. These types of logos add a personalized touch to a business’s brand identity and can create a strong connection with customers.
  • Vintage Aesthetic: Retro-inspired logos with a vintage look and feel are making a comeback in the gardening industry. These logos often use earthy tones, classic typography, and nostalgic imagery to evoke a sense of timeless charm and authenticity.

Hiring a Professional Logo Designer vs DIY Logo Design

When it comes to creating a logo for your gardening business, one of the biggest decisions you’ll face is whether to hire a professional designer or take on the task yourself. Both options have their pros and cons, and it’s important to carefully consider which route will best suit your needs and budget.

Hiring a professional logo designer can offer many advantages. These experts have the skills and experience to create a high-quality, unique logo that effectively represents your brand. They can also provide valuable insight and guidance throughout the design process. Additionally, professional designers are well-versed in industry trends and best practices, ensuring that your logo will be both timeless and relevant.

On the other hand, opting for a DIY logo design may be more cost-effective for some gardening businesses. With the abundance of online design tools and resources available, it’s easier than ever for entrepreneurs to create their own logos without professional assistance. This approach allows for greater creative control and flexibility, as well as the ability to experiment with different ideas and concepts.

Of course, there are also drawbacks to consider when choosing DIY logo design. Without formal training or experience in graphic design, business owners may struggle to achieve a polished and professional result. Additionally, DIY logos run the risk of appearing generic or uninspired if not executed with care and attention to detail.
